4.5.6. Let the random variable X denote the number of trials in excess of r that are required to achieve the rth success in a series of independent trials, where p is the probability of success at any given trial. Show that ktr-1 Px ( k ) = k p'(1 - p)", k = 0, 1, 2, . . . (Note: This particular formula for py (k) is often used in place of Equation 4.5.1 as the definition of the pdf for a negative binomial random variable.)
